What is the Identification Verification Form?
The Identification Verification Form is a critical document utilized by Canadian financial institutions to validate the identities of borrowers and guarantors. This form is vital in the lending process as it helps prevent fraud and ensures compliance with Canadian anti-money laundering legislation. It serves to protect both lenders and borrowers by establishing a reliable identification process, which is essential in today's financial landscape.

Key Features of the Identification Verification Form
This form includes several essential components designed to capture necessary identification information accurately. Key fields include 'Photo ID Name', 'Current Address', and 'Date of Birth'. Additionally, the form requires the agent's signature to confirm the verification process. The design also incorporates multi-fillable fields that enhance the accuracy of data entry, ensuring all details are correctly documented.
-
'Photo ID Name'
-
'Current Address'
-
'Date of Birth'
-
Agent's signature requirement

Who is required to fill out the Identification Verification Form?
The Identification Verification Form is typically required by agents representing financial institutions who need to verify the identity of borrowers and guarantors as part of the loan processing.
What identification documents are needed?
You will need to provide a government-issued photo ID, proof of address, and any personal identification details necessary for the form. Ensure all documents are current and valid.
